单行注释中断javascript执行
我使用单行注释中断javascript执行,javascript,android,webview,Javascript,Android,Webview,我使用webview.loadData(数据,“text/html”,null)将此html加载到webview中 mydiv=document.getElementById(“mydiv”); //评论 mydiv.style.backgroundColor=“红色”; 这只是一个红色背景的正方形div。webview中的JavaScript已启用。 但是//注释下面的行不起作用。没有任何评论,它按预期工作。 你能证实这一点吗? sdk 25尝试使用多行注释(/**/)。尝试使用多行注释(
webview.loadData(数据,“text/html”,null)将此html加载到webview中代码>
mydiv=document.getElementById(“mydiv”);
//评论
mydiv.style.backgroundColor=“红色”;
这只是一个红色背景的正方形div。webview中的JavaScript已启用。
但是//注释下面的行不起作用。没有任何评论,它按预期工作。
你能证实这一点吗?
sdk 25尝试使用多行注释(/**/)。尝试使用多行注释(/**/)。注释不会破坏我的页面。如果我使用loadUrl()从服务器加载页面,我的页面实际上可以正常工作如果我从字符串加载,则失败。注释不会为我打断它。如果我使用loadUrl()从服务器加载,则我的页面实际上可以正常工作,如果我从字符串加载,则失败。
<!DOCTYPE html>
<html>
<body>
<div ID="mydiv" style="width:100px; height:100px; border-style:solid;">
</div>
</body>
<script>
mydiv = document.getElementById("mydiv");
//comment
mydiv.style.backgroundColor = "red";
</script>
</html>